Roasted Beet and Carrot Salad

1 lb red beets, scrubbed, peeled, and thinly sliced
1 lb yellow beets, scrubbed, peeled, and thinly sliced
6 medium carrots, thinly sliced
3 Tbsp olive oil
seas salt and pepper
3 Tbsp orange juice
1 1/2 tsp sherry vinegar
1 1/2 tsp chopped fresh tarragon leaves
3 small Belgian endives, trimmed, halved lengthwise, and cut into 1-inch pieces
4 oz fresh goat cheese, crumbled
1/3 c. chopped toasted pecans

Preheat oven to 450. On a rimmed baking sheet, toss beets and carrots with 1 1/2 Tbsp oil; season with salt a pepper. Roast until tender, 25-30 minutes, tossing halfway through. Let cool 5 minutes.

Meanwhile,in a small bowl, whisk together orange juice, vinegar, tarragon, and 1 1/2 tsp oil; season with salt and pepper. In a large bowl, toss endives with half the dressing, then transfer to a serving platter. Toss beets and carrots with remaining dressing and add to platter. Top with goat cheese and pecans.

[EDIT: this recipe works much better if you blanch the beets and carrots ahead of time, otherwise they tend to dry out when they are roasted. Extra amazing if you grill the veggies. This is frequent friend request recipe. If you make it for Dad, replace the goat cheese with anything non-goat.]
